Transaction 597c105eddc20679a640d16606c8330ffc5e164deec130d876f61c9de1b5715f
1 Input
1 Output
-
597c105eddc20679a640d16606c8330ffc5e164deec130d876f61c9de1b5715f:0
- value
- 2019025
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ba74483b506d26eeff3f452e40356c0b09d66729
- address
- bc1qhf6ysw6sd5nwalelg5hyqdtvpvyaveefu3qjm2